Transaction 68c13831cdda532a72885621ca5521e4c93e9dcadc167779d32021062e30cfe1

1 Input
2 Outputs
  • 68c13831cdda532a72885621ca5521e4c93e9dcadc167779d32021062e30cfe1:0
  • value  47375
    address  37dA8NoJBkhpDCoCeaJbnkhMc7gyCs1foQ
  • 68c13831cdda532a72885621ca5521e4c93e9dcadc167779d32021062e30cfe1:1
  • value  27391830
    address  194mJk2VU43vZTan4sVoKV7tHMiPbsUs9c